Road cycling routes around Brackel are characterized by a landscape of gentle hills, open heathland, and river valleys. The region offers varied terrain suitable for road cyclists seeking both flat sections and moderate ascents. Elevation gains on routes typically remain below 200 meters, providing accessible cycling experiences. The area's network of paved roads connects rural communities and natural areas.

There are over 240 road cycling routes around Brackel, offering a wide variety of options for different skill levels and preferences. This includes 110 easy routes, 131 moderate routes, and 5 more challenging options.
Road cycling routes around Brackel feature a diverse landscape of gentle hills, open heathland, and picturesque river valleys. The terrain offers a mix of flat sections and moderate ascents, with elevation gains typically remaining below 200 meters, making it accessible for many cyclists.
Yes, Brackel offers many easy road cycling routes perfect for beginners. For example, the Smooth Trail in Lüneburg Heath – Lake With Island loop from Tangendorf is an easy 37.3 km route with smooth surfaces through heathland. Another great option is the Avenue near Marxen in the Auetal – Sunrise View Near Ramelsloh loop from Jesteburg, an easy 22.8 km path featuring scenic avenues.
For those looking for a moderate challenge, routes like the Long Climb from Garlstorf loop from Hanstedt offer varied landscapes over 27.1 km. Another popular moderate route is the Avenue near Marxen in the Auetal – Holmer Watermill loop from Marxen, which covers 33.9 km.
Many road cycling routes in Brackel are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the easy Smooth Trail in Lüneburg Heath – Lake With Island loop from Tangendorf and the moderate Long Climb from Garlstorf loop from Hanstedt.
Road cycling routes in Brackel offer picturesque views of open heathland, tranquil river valleys, and charming rural landscapes. You'll often find yourself cycling through areas with natural beauty, such as the Lüneburg Heath, providing a serene backdrop for your ride.
The road cycling routes in Brackel are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.6 stars from over 400 reviews. Cyclists often praise the well-maintained paved roads, the varied yet accessible terrain, and the beautiful natural scenery of the heathland and river valleys.
While cycling around Brackel, you can explore several interesting attractions. Notable natural sites include the expansive Lüneburg Heath Nature Reserve and Wesel Heath. You might also encounter historical structures like the Horster Mill — Watermill and Restaurant or cross the Hoopte Ferry on the River Elbe.
Yes, you can find several shelters and rest stops in the vicinity of Brackel's cycling routes. These include spots like the Geidenhütte Shelter (Auf dem Töps), Udo's Hut, and Udo's Rest Stop on the Bicycle Highway, providing convenient places to pause during your ride.
The best season for road cycling in Brackel is typically from spring through autumn (April to October). During these months, the weather is generally mild, and the heathland is particularly beautiful, especially in late summer when the heather blooms. While winter cycling is possible, be prepared for colder temperatures and potentially icy conditions.
Yes, the road cycling routes around Brackel primarily utilize a network of well-paved roads. This ensures a smooth and enjoyable experience for road cyclists, connecting rural communities and natural areas with good surface quality.
